Fryeburg and Rumford are places in Maine.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.
Rumford has the higher population (4,017 vs 1,665 in Fryeburg). Fryeburg has the higher median household income ($61,944 vs $32,240 in Rumford). Fryeburg has the higher median home value ($268,100 vs $115,300 in Rumford).
Population, income & housing
| Fryeburg | Rumford |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 1,665 | 4,017 |
| Median age | 48.8 yrs | 54.4 yrs |
| Median household income | $61,944 | $32,240 |
| Median home value | $268,100 | $115,300 |
| Median gross rent | $869 | $622 |
| Housing units | 729 | 2,686 |
| Homeownership rate | 69.3% | 57.2% |
| Bachelor's degree or higher | 19.3% | 16.0% |
| Unemployment rate | 5.9% | 6.6% |
Trends (ACS 5-year, 2019–2023)
| Fryeburg | Rumford |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 1,542 → 1,665 (+8.0%) | 3,672 → 4,017 (+9.4%) |
| Median household income | $53,684 → $61,944 (+15.4%) | $34,958 → $32,240 (-7.8%) |
| Median home value | $175,500 → $268,100 (+52.8%) | $78,000 → $115,300 (+47.8%) |
| Median gross rent | $644 → $869 (+34.9%) | $570 → $622 (+9.1%) |
